LINUX.ORG.RU

8
Всего сообщений: 188

как заставить KDE 5 выглядеть как KDE4 ?

и как так вышло, что у 5-ки из коробки помоечный дизайн, в то время, как 4-ка - образец дизайна?

 , , , ,

next_time ()

apt --ingnore-missing

Надоело перепаковывать пакеты, чтобы ставились в новых ОС. Даже если поставить пакет как есть через dpkg, то потом через apt не поставить вообще ничего, пока не удалишь этот самый пакет.
Может кто знает волшебные опции для apt, позволяющие оставить зависимости нерешенными для некоторых пакетов, при этом не ломая установку новых пакетов ? Собсна опция из заголовка не помогает, вообще непонятен смысл её существования.

 , , , ,

Deleted ()

NoReverseMatch прошу помощи

Добрый день ЛОР. Имеется модель:

class Loureats(models.Model):

    class Meta():
        db_table='loureats'
        verbose_name='Лоуреат'
        verbose_name_plural='Лоуреати'

    year = models.ForeignKey(LoureatsYear, on_delete=models.CASCADE, blank=True, null=True)
    name = models.CharField(verbose_name='Название', max_length=400)
    logo = ProcessedImageField(verbose_name='Логотип', upload_to='loureats/', processors=[ResizeToFit(300)], format='JPEG',
                                options={'quality': 90})
    description = models.TextField(verbose_name='О луореате')
    photo = ProcessedImageField(upload_to='loureats/photo/', processors=[ResizeToFit(300)], format='JPEG',
                                options={'quality': 90})
    create = models.DateTimeField(verbose_name='Дата создания', default=timezone.now)
    update = models.DateTimeField(verbose_name='Дата обновления', auto_now=True)
    moder = models.BooleanField(verbose_name='Модерация', default=False)

    def __str__(self):
        return self.name

Вьюха:

def loureats_list(reguest, slug):
    year = LoureatsYear.objects.get(slug=slug)
    loureats = Loureats.objects.filter(year=year)
    return render(reguest, 'loureats/loureats_list.html', {
        'year': year,
        'loureats': loureats}
    )

def loureats_detail(request, pk):
    template='loureats/loureats_detail.html'
    loureats_detail = get_object_or_404(Loureats, pk=pk)
    return render(request, template, {'loureats_detail': loureats_detail})

urls:

path('loureats/<slug>/', views.loureats_list, name='loureats_list'),
path('loureats/<pk>/', views.loureats_detail, name='loureats_detail'),

И ссылка в шаблоне для перехода к детальному описанию:

{% for item in loureats %}
<h1><a href="{% url 'base:loureats_detail' pk=loureats_detail.pk %}">{{ item.name }}</a></h1>
{% endfor %}

При переходе loureats/<slug>/ получаю такую ошибку:

Reverse for 'loureats_detail' with keyword arguments '{'pk': "}' not found. 1 pattern(s) tried: ['loureats\\/(?P<pk>[^/]+)\\/$']

Новости вывожу таким же образом, и все работает. Что я делаю не так?

 ,

xaTa ()

Ошибка во время устновки Android SDK

[1,796s][info][classload] java.nio.file.AccessDeniedException source: jrt:/java.base

а именно во время запуска./sdkmanager

понятно, что доступ к файлу запрещён, но с чего бы и к какому? жаба установлена нормально, местные жабоприложения вполне идут без проблем

//Жду, когда gradle перестанет останавливаться на достигнутом и будет просить новый sdk не раз в месяц, а, хотя бы, раз в час

 ,

next_time ()

VIM и ваши пальцы.

Привет лоровцы! Возник такой вопрос. Бывали ли у вас проблемы с болью в пальцах от того что много писали код в вим? У меня редко, но бывает. Как вы это решаете?

P.S. У меня знакомый ушел с вима, так как по его мнению, от вима даже может развиваться тунельный синдром!? Что простите?

 ,

Siansor ()

Нет ли реализации fuse драйвера для HTTPCommander ?

По работе теперь приходится пользоваться недоразумением под названием HTTPcommander. Может кто знает, есть ли удобный клиент для работы с ним, как например есть для *cloud|Ydisk|Gdisk и т.п. ?

 , ,

Deleted ()

Что поставить в виртуалку, чтобы не было боли с настройкой?

Шалом, нужен простой в настройке дистр для виртуалки, чтобы внутри него можно было запустить мелкомягкий офис, пару специфичных виндовых программ и чтобы работал модуль vboxsf.

Или проще мелкомягкую ОС в виртуалку накатить?

ЗЫ чет совсем со времен хр не занимался странными вещами с компом. Была виртуалка со всем этим специфичным мелкомягким софтом на хр, но критичный для меня софт перестал под ней обновляться...

ЗЗЫ приглядываюсь к Можаро, тому що приятель арчелюб, да и вокруг арча веселое сообщество с блекарчем и куртизанками.

Вот так вот. Поливайте ответами, гойспода.

 , ,

Deleted ()

ipad и openvpn

Не думал я, что на старости придётся взять в руки этот самый ипад. Этот самый ипад жене подарила подруга, я его разумеется проклял, но теперь ей понадобилось в дальних странствиях удалённо заходить на домашний комп рулить там всяким, что на ипаде в принципе не поднять. За один вечер я успел возненавидеть это устройство. Теперь сижу и думаю - купить ей какой-нить планшет или у впн пароли включить. Потому что как заставить приложение увидеть сертификаты, лежащие рядом с конфигом я не допёр. А ещё предстоит подключить к этому, с позволения сказать, устройству синезубых мышь и клаву... Может проще купить Нексус какой-нибудь? У неё есть т60, но тяжёловат, хочет планшет.

 , ,

WerNA ()

Gnome 3 - боль при использовании клавиатуры и мыши

Переключение раскладки:

- невозможно назначить на КапсЛок. Эту тему Gnome 3 переключение раскладки. читал. Ни что из этого не помогает. Единственный метод - установка сессии Юнити и назначение Капслока в ней. Но после этого КапсЛок не только перелкючает раскладки но и одновременно лочит шифт.

- при переключении раскладки оно тормозит так, что начинаешь подозревать, что оно каждый раз скачивает нужную раскладку из Интернета. Эту тему тоже читал: Испортили переключение раскладки (комментарий) - она не применима, потому что предложенные в ней инструменты, как я писал выше, не могут внести изменение в настройки переключения раскладки.

- невозможно настроить открытие меню приложений на клавишу открытия меню приложений - Супер. Вообще создается такое ощущение, что создатели, специально для каждого действия прописали в исключения ту кнопку, которую наиболее удобно использовать для него

- невозоможно настроить переключение рабочих столов на кнопки для мыши

- невозможно добавить рабочие столы по горизонтали - только вертикальное расположение

Да, Убунту 18.04 и соответственно Гном 3.28, а линукс тут не при чем.

 , , , ,

Suntechnic ()

Как компилить 64 бит бинарники в MinGW из под wine?

Скачал инсталлятор mingw-w64-install.exe, запустил вайном, установил новый компилятор, пытаюсь собрать им простейшую библиотеку, а «лыжи не едут»:

wine cmd
pat.bat
cd libogg-1.3.3
configure --enable-static
Получаю
config.status: creating config.h
config.status: executing depfiles commands
config.status: executing libtool commands
и сборка чего-то ждёт, жму энтер и пытаюсь вызвать make, но в компиляторе есть только такой mingw32-make.exe, пытаюсь собрать им
mingw32-make.exe
Makefile:386: *** target pattern contains no '%'.  Stop.
и получаю ошибку. Как же всё-таки из под вайна им собирать 64 битные бинарники?

 , , ,

Napilnik ()

Xfce: не меняются настройки уведомлений

Собственно, проблема вся в заголовке - при смене темы, длительности и месте вывода уведомлений не происходит абсолютно _ничего_. Где копать? Может, прав ему каких не хватает или чего-то такого?

 , , , ,

meliafaro ()

Groovy: .each?

Всем привет!

Вопрос прозвучит странно, но все же:

Есть ли в groovy какой-то аналог .each, но с возможностью указать рейндж?

 ,

gadzira ()

Debian 9 крашится при выходе из hibernate.

Проблема описана в заголовке.

Гугление не добавило ничего кроме https://unix.stackexchange.com/questions/377973/hibernation-resume-fail-on-li...

Но это оказалось бесполезно.

Ядро 4.9.0-6-686 без PAE. uswsusp не установлен.

 , ,

shkolnick-kun ()

Wysisyg и прочие плагины для drupal

Какие вообще есть? Если начинать копать в интернете, то советуют либо CKEditor, либо модуль блог wysiwyg(который поддерживает десяток эдиторов). Попробовал все предложенное и ничего не понравилось. Редакторы либо глючные(нажимаешь enter, а перескакивает на 2-3 строки), либо не умеют элементарно загружать картинки(да, я знаю что надо дополнительный модуль для этого дела ставить, но с ним кроме CKEditor ничто работать не хочет). Про подсветку синтаксиса(даже не подсветку, а просто сделать текст моноширинным с нумерацией строк и все это в отдельном блоке с другим цветом фона) можно тоже забыть, есть пара модулей, но они опять же не интегрируются нормально в редакторы.

UPD:
1. wysisyg не нужен, drupal умеет из коробки корректно обрабатывать переносы строк и подсвечивать ссылки
2. geshi без wysiwyg редакторов работает как надо
3. Осталось решить вопрос с загрузкой изображений через админку

 ,

Deleted ()

Я что-то делаю не так, или «это норма»?

Есть такой вопрос про bluetooth. Есть железо:

[1] Android Pixel, Sony z5c, Samsung A5 (Android)

[2] Major II BT, до этого были какие-то Platronics

[3] Lenovo W451 (Linux)

[4] Гарнитура в машине

2+3 работает идеально. 1+4 - идеально. 1+2 - боль, ад, лаги, западание, «статические разряды». AptX включен или нет - вроде не сильно влияет. В трамвае - ад в квадрате. На работе - просто много выпадающих моментов. Дома - более-менее. В машине в наушниках пока не сидел, вроде как не очень законно.

Это работают средства РЭБ? Засран диапазон? Телефон экономит батарею и у него очень слабый сигнал? Почему с ноутом все ОК? Почему телефон нормально работает с гарнитурой в машине? У всех так?

 , , ,

Shaman007 ()

Numpy Structured Array

Подскажите плз как с сабжем нормально работать? Цель - попытка заменить невероятно тормозной пандас.

Основная проблема - построчно с этой штукой отказывается работать большая часть np. Ну например надо тупо перемножить массив из одной строки с другим и подсчитать сумму элементов. Можно извратиться типа (A * np.asarray(B.item())).sum(), но это дичь какая-то.

я в целом понимаю что это связано с возможным (и крайне вероятным) различием dtype у каждого из элементов. Но блин, мне по факту в 99% случаев все что нужно от этого массива это имена полей. dtype в большинстве мест (кроме нескольких) у всех полей один и тот же. Может есть что-то еще кроме struct array для этого? Можно в целом держать dict с именами столбцов рядом, но это жесткий геморрой

 , ,

upcFrost ()

GIMP и Paint.NET

Проблема. Есть замечательный Paint.NET, написанный на шарпике и плюсах. Разрабы почему-то не удосужились (не захотели) сделать его работоспособным на линухе и маке. Сорцы, ясно-понятно, тоже закрыты. Но в плане UX от великолепен. Мелкомягкий пэинт как был калом - так стал ещё каловее и вонючее, я вообще не знаю, начерта он теперь кому-то здался. А вот Paint.NET, да...

О чём это я. Приходится периодически фоточку подправить, подрезать, заблюрить, заскалить, несколько слоёв налепить, что-то там вырезать умной вырезалкой, смержить это всё, выплюнуть в виде файла. Всё это прекрасно умеет GIMP. Но сколько я с ним ни вожусь, а вожусь уже не первый год редкими набегами, каждый раз он вызывает у меня анальные боли.

Я уже выделил время, нашёл вменяемые обучающие уроки по нему, посмотрел их, и только больше убедился, что GIMP писали черти из ада с целью нанесения психических увечий тем, кто будет им пользоваться.

Вопросы довольно сложные. Что делать? Чем пользоваться? Почему нет адекватных кроссплатформенных растровых редакторов?

 , , ,

ShadowMaker ()

Alt + Shift блокирует ввод текста в Ubuntu 17.10 (Unity)

Всегда использовал такой способ: Жму Alt + Shift что бы сменить раскладку и отпускаю ТОЛЬКО alt, что бы дальше продолжить вводить символ или большую букву.

А сейчас в Ubuntu что-то сломали или (намеренно сделали) и пока зажат шифт - ввод текста не работает!

Т.е. баг повторяется так:

1. Жмём alt

2. Жмём shift

3. Отпускаем только alt

4. Пробуем вводить текст - он не вводится. Окно даже не в фокусе.

Если использовать Shift-Alt, то баг не повторяется.

Кто нибудь сталкивался с этим багом?

Просто жить не даёт, не могу даже просто текст набирать.

 , ,

Azq2 ()

context_processors

Доброго времени суток. Пытаюсь выводить теги в шаблон контекстным процессором, все бы хорошо да выводятся теги только на одной странице. Постараюсь описать проект что было понятнее.

testproj/
    manage.py
    testproj/
        __init__.py
        settings.py
        urls.py
        wsgi.py
    base/
        __init__.py
        admin.py
        apps.py
        context_processors.py
        models.py
        tests.py
        urls.py
        views.py
        templates/
            base/
                base.html
    compilation/
        __init__.py
        admin.py
        apps.py
        models.py
        tests.py
        urls.py
        views.py
        templates/
            compilation/
                index.html
    movie/
        __init__.py
        admin.py
        apps.py
        models.py
        tests.py
        urls.py
        views.py
        templates/
            movie/
                index.html

base - отвечает за основную страницу и базовые шаблоны(тут я и задумал выводить теги)

compilation - отвечает за категории

movie - отвечает за контент

Теги выводятся только когда обращаюсь к приложению compilation.

Контекстный процессор регистрировал тут:

TEMPLATES = [
	{
		'BACKEND': 'django.template.backends.django.DjangoTemplates',
		'DIRS': [],
		'APP_DIRS': True,
		'OPTIONS': {
			'context_processors': [
				'django.template.context_processors.debug',
				'django.template.context_processors.request',
				'django.contrib.auth.context_processors.auth',
				'django.contrib.messages.context_processors.messages',
				'base.context_processors.base_sidebar',
			],
		},
	},
]

Может кто обьяснит что за полтергейст?

 ,

xaTa ()

Кто-то смеялся над Эдди????

Нужно проверить орфографию по своему словарю (поиск по базе товара).
MySpell словари в кодировке koi8. Под Windows. В 2018!!!!!

И это особенность myspell

PS. Notepad++ справился.

 , , ,

Shadow ()